Uncategorized

Practical guidance for building a successful site with enhanced user experience

Practical guidance for building a successful site with enhanced user experience

Creating a digital presence begins with a well-crafted online destination. A site, whether for personal expression, business promotion, or information dissemination, acts as a central hub for connecting with an audience. The modern digital landscape demands more than just a functional website; it requires an intuitive, engaging, and accessible experience for every visitor. Building a successful online presence necessitates careful planning, thoughtful design, and ongoing maintenance to ensure it remains relevant and effective.

The process extends beyond simply publishing content. It involves understanding the target audience, optimizing for search engines, ensuring mobile responsiveness, and prioritizing security. A successful online presence isn't a static entity but a dynamic platform that evolves with user needs and technological advancements. Without a clear strategy and commitment to quality, even the most visually appealing website can fail to achieve its intended purpose. Therefore, a holistic approach – blending design, technology, and marketing principles – is crucial.

Understanding Your Audience and Defining Your Goals

Before diving into the technical aspects of building a web presence, it’s essential to thoroughly understand who you're trying to reach. Defining your target demographic – considering their age, interests, online behavior, and technical proficiency – will inform every decision, from content creation to site design. Are you targeting tech-savvy millennials, or a more mature audience less familiar with the latest digital trends? The answer will dramatically shape your approach. Furthermore, clearly articulating your goals is paramount. Are you aiming to generate leads, drive sales, build brand awareness, or establish yourself as an industry thought leader? Your objectives should be specific, measurable, achievable, relevant, and time-bound (SMART). A website built without a defined purpose is like a ship without a rudder – destined to drift aimlessly.

The Importance of User Personas

Developing user personas—semi-fictional representations of your ideal customers—can be incredibly valuable. These personas go beyond basic demographics, incorporating details about their motivations, frustrations, and online habits. For example, a persona might be “Sarah, a 35-year-old marketing manager who is seeking solutions to streamline her team's workflow.” Understanding Sarah's pain points and needs will help you create content and design a user interface that directly addresses her challenges. Creating several personas ensures that your website caters to a diverse range of potential visitors, maximizing its appeal and effectiveness. This focused approach leads to more impactful results than a generic 'one-size-fits-all' strategy.

Persona Age Occupation Key Goals
David 28 Software Engineer Find technical documentation, connect with other developers.
Emily 45 Business Owner Generate leads, increase online sales, build brand awareness.
Robert 62 Retired Teacher Access information, connect with others sharing similar interests.
Jessica 31 Marketing Specialist Research industry trends, find inspiration, network with peers.

Having a table like this readily available during the design and content creation phases acts as a constant reminder of who you're building the online experience for, ensuring that decisions are user-centric and aligned with overall business objectives.

Designing for Optimal User Experience

User experience (UX) is arguably the most critical aspect of any successful website. A positive UX keeps visitors engaged, encourages them to explore further, and ultimately increases the likelihood of achieving your desired outcomes. This goes far beyond aesthetics; it encompasses usability, accessibility, and overall satisfaction. Intuitive navigation is paramount. Visitors should be able to easily find what they’re looking for without confusion or frustration. Clear calls to action (CTAs) are equally important, guiding users toward desired actions, such as making a purchase, filling out a form, or contacting your team. Website speed is also a significant factor. Slow loading times can lead to high bounce rates, as users quickly abandon sites that don't perform optimally. Optimize images, leverage browser caching, and consider using a Content Delivery Network (CDN) to improve loading speeds.

Mobile-First Design Considerations

In today’s mobile-dominated world, adopting a "mobile-first" design philosophy is no longer optional – it's essential. More and more users are accessing the internet primarily through smartphones and tablets, so your website must be fully responsive and adapt seamlessly to different screen sizes. This means designing for smaller screens first, then progressively enhancing the experience for larger displays. Avoid using Flash or other outdated technologies that aren't compatible with mobile devices. Prioritize touch-friendly navigation, and ensure that all elements are easily clickable on a touchscreen. Regularly test your website on a variety of mobile devices to identify and address any responsiveness issues. A poor mobile experience can severely damage your brand reputation and hinder your ability to reach a large segment of your target audience.

  • Prioritize clear and concise content.
  • Use visual hierarchy to guide the user’s eye.
  • Ensure all interactive elements are easily accessible.
  • Test your website on various devices and browsers.
  • Regularly gather user feedback and iterate on your design.

Effective website design isn't just about aesthetics; it's about creating a seamless and enjoyable experience that meets the needs of your target audience and achieves your business goals. By prioritizing UX and embracing a mobile-first approach, you can significantly increase engagement and conversions.

Search Engine Optimization (SEO) Best Practices

Building a beautiful and user-friendly website is only half the battle. You also need to ensure that it’s easily discoverable by search engines like Google. Search Engine Optimization (SEO) is the process of optimizing your website to rank higher in search results, driving organic traffic and increasing visibility. Keyword research is the foundation of any successful SEO strategy. Identify the terms and phrases that your target audience is using to search for information related to your products or services. Incorporate these keywords naturally into your website content, title tags, meta descriptions, and image alt text. However, avoid keyword stuffing, which can harm your rankings. Content quality is another critical factor. Search engines prioritize websites that provide valuable, informative, and engaging content. Regularly updating your website with fresh, relevant content signals to search engines that your site is active and authoritative.

Technical SEO Elements

Technical SEO refers to the behind-the-scenes optimizations that improve your website’s crawlability and indexability. This includes ensuring that your website has a clean and logical structure, using descriptive URLs, creating a sitemap, and submitting it to search engines. Optimizing your website’s loading speed is also crucial, as search engines prioritize faster-loading sites. Furthermore, implementing schema markup can help search engines understand the content on your pages more accurately, potentially enhancing your search results with rich snippets. A well-optimized website is easier for search engines to crawl and understand, increasing your chances of ranking higher in search results. This, in turn, drives more organic traffic and establishes your online authority.

  1. Conduct thorough keyword research.
  2. Optimize your website’s content for relevant keywords.
  3. Build high-quality backlinks from authoritative websites.
  4. Ensure your website is mobile-friendly.
  5. Monitor your SEO performance and make adjustments as needed.

A comprehensive SEO strategy combines on-page optimization, off-page optimization (link building), and technical SEO to improve your website's visibility and attract qualified traffic.

Ensuring Website Security

In an increasingly interconnected world, website security is paramount. A security breach can have devastating consequences, including data loss, financial damage, and reputational harm. Protecting your website from cyber threats requires a multi-layered approach. Using a strong and unique password for your website's admin panel is a fundamental step. Regularly updating your website's software, including the content management system (CMS), themes, and plugins, is also crucial to patch security vulnerabilities. Installing a security plugin or firewall can provide an additional layer of protection, blocking malicious traffic and preventing attacks. Regularly backing up your website’s data is essential, allowing you to restore your site in the event of a security breach or other disaster. Consider enabling two-factor authentication for added security.

Proactive security measures are far more effective than reactive ones. Regularly monitoring your website for suspicious activity and staying informed about the latest security threats can help you prevent attacks before they occur. Choosing a reputable web hosting provider with robust security measures is also vital, as they play a crucial role in protecting your website from external threats. Ignoring website security is a risky proposition that can have severe consequences for your business.

Leveraging Analytics for Continuous Improvement

Building a successful online presence isn’t a “set it and forget it” endeavor. It requires continuous monitoring, analysis, and optimization. Leveraging web analytics tools, such as Google Analytics, allows you to track key metrics and gain valuable insights into user behavior. Analyzing data such as bounce rate, time on page, conversion rates, and traffic sources can help you identify areas for improvement. For example, a high bounce rate on a particular page might indicate that the content is irrelevant or the user experience is poor. Identifying these issues allows you to make data-driven decisions that improve your website’s performance. A/B testing different versions of your website can help you determine which elements are most effective at driving conversions. Analyzing the results can reveal valuable insights into user preferences, allowing you to refine your design and content accordingly.

Regularly reviewing your analytics data and implementing data-driven changes is crucial for maximizing the effectiveness of your website and achieving your business goals. The online landscape is constantly evolving, so it's important to stay adaptable and continuously optimize your online presence.

Leave a Reply

Your email address will not be published. Required fields are marked *